										 |  |  | // ffmpegGenerateThumb generates a thumbnail webp from input media of any type, useful for any media. |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-12 09:39:47 +00:00
										 |  |  | func ffmpegGenerateThumb(ctx context.Context, filepath string, width, height int) (string, error) { |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-19 15:28:43 +00:00
										 |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-12 09:39:47 +00:00
										 |  |  | 	// Get directory from filepath.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	dirpath := path.Dir(filepath) |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	// Generate output frame file path. |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-19 15:28:43 +00:00
										 |  |  | 	outpath := filepath + "_thumb.webp"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	// Thumbnail size scaling argument.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	scale := strconv.Itoa(width) + ":" + |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		strconv.Itoa(height) |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-12 09:39:47 +00:00
										 |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	// Generate thumb with ffmpeg.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	if err := ffmpeg(ctx, dirpath, |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		"-loglevel", "error", |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-19 15:28:43 +00:00
										 |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// Input file. |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-12 09:39:47 +00:00
										 |  |  | 		"-i", filepath, |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-19 15:28:43 +00:00
										 |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// Encode using libwebp.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// (NOT as libwebp_anim). |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		"-codec:v", "libwebp", |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// Select thumb from first 10 frames |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// (thumb filter: https://ffmpeg.org/ffmpeg-filters.html#thumbnail) |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		"-filter:v", "thumbnail=n=10,"+ |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			// scale to dimensions |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			// (scale filter: https://ffmpeg.org/ffmpeg-filters.html#scale) |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			"scale="+scale+","+ |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			// YUVA 4:2:0 pixel format |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			// (format filter: https://ffmpeg.org/ffmpeg-filters.html#format) |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			"format=pix_fmts=yuva420p", |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// Only one frame |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-12 09:39:47 +00:00
										 |  |  | 		"-frames:v", "1", |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-19 15:28:43 +00:00
										 |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// ~40% webp quality |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// (codec options: https://ffmpeg.org/ffmpeg-codecs.html#toc-Codec-Options) |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// (libwebp codec: https://ffmpeg.org/ffmpeg-codecs.html#Options-36) |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		"-qscale:v", "40", |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// Overwrite. |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-12 09:39:47 +00:00
										 |  |  | 		"-y", |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-19 15:28:43 +00:00
										 |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		// Output. |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-12 09:39:47 +00:00
										 |  |  | 		outpath, |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	); err != nil {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return "", err |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	} |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	return outpath, nil |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| } |

							|  |  |  | // GetFileType determines file type and extension to use for media data. This |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| // function helps to abstract away the horrible complexities that are possible |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| // media container (i.e. the file) types and and possible sub-types within that.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| // |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| // Note the checks for (len(res.video) > 0) may catch some audio files with embedded |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| // album art as video, but i blame that on the hellscape that is media filetypes.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| // |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| // TODO: we can update this code to also return a mimetype and avoid later parsing! |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| func (res *result) GetFileType() (gtsmodel.FileType, string) {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	switch res.format {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"mpeg":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eVideo, "mpeg"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"mjpeg":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eVideo, "mjpeg"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"mov,mp4,m4a,3gp,3g2,mj2":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		switch {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		case len(res.video) > 0: |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			return gtsmodel.FileTypeVideo, "mp4"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		case len(res.audio) > 0 && |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			res.audio[0].codec == "aac":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			// m4a only supports [aac] audio.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			return gtsmodel.FileTypeAudio, "m4a" |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 11:47:57 +02:00
										 |  |  | 		} |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 14:24:53 +00:00
										 |  |  | 	case "apng":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eImage, "apng"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"png_pipe":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eImage, "png"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"image2", "image2pipe", "jpeg_pipe":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eImage, "jpeg"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"webp", "webp_pipe":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eImage, "webp"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"gif":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eImage, "gif"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"mp3":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		if len(res.audio) > 0 {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			switch res.audio[0].codec {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			case "mp2":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 				return gtsmodel.FileTypeAudio, "mp2"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			case "mp3":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 				return gtsmodel.FileTypeAudio, "mp3"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			} |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 11:47:57 +02:00
										 |  |  | 		} |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 14:24:53 +00:00
										 |  |  | 	case "asf":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		switch {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		case len(res.video) > 0: |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			return gtsmodel.FileTypeVideo, "wmv"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		case len(res.audio) > 0: |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			return gtsmodel.FileTypeAudio, "wma"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		} |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"ogg":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		switch {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		case len(res.video) > 0: |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			return gtsmodel.FileTypeVideo, "ogv"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		case len(res.audio) > 0: |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			return gtsmodel.FileTypeAudio, "ogg"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		} |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 	case "matroska,webm":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		switch {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		case len(res.video) > 0: |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			switch res.video[0].codec {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			case "vp8", "vp9", "av1":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			default: |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 				return gtsmodel.FileTypeVideo, "mkv" |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 11:47:57 +02:00
										 |  |  | 			} |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 14:24:53 +00:00
										 |  |  | 			if len(res.audio) > 0 {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 				switch res.audio[0].codec { |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 				case "vorbis", "opus", "libopus":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 					// webm only supports [VP8/VP9/AV1]+[vorbis/opus] |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 					return gtsmodel.FileTypeVideo, "webm" |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 				} |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			} |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		case len(res.audio) > 0: |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 			return gtsmodel.FileTypeAudio, "mka" |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 11:47:57 +02:00
										 |  |  | 		} |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 14:24:53 +00:00
										 |  |  | 	case "avi":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eVideo, "avi" |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-21 13:42:51 +01:00
										 |  |  | 	case "flac": |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| 		return gtsmodel.FileTypeAudio, "flac" |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 11:47:57 +02:00
										 |  |  | 	} |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 14:24:53 +00:00
										 |  |  | 	return gtsmodel.FileTypeUnknown, res.format |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2024-07-15 11:47:57 +02:00
										 |  |  | } |
